problemas con el permiso de homebrew de osx

0

Tengo muchos problemas de permisos en mi máquina OSX 10.13.4. Homebrew parece no poder terminar correctamente la instalación del paquete correctamente.

Aquí está el siguiente ejemplo para npm pero tengo el mismo problema con node. Parece que ambos están instalados pero no están vinculados a mi entorno si lo entiendo bien. He intentado todo lo que pude encontrar pero me estoy quedando sin ideas. También intenté desinstalar / reinstalar Homebrew

brew install npm Me sale un error de enlace simbólico:

Error: The `brew link` step did not complete successfully
The formula built, but is not symlinked into /usr/local
Could not symlink include/node/android-ifaddrs.h
/usr/local/include/node is not writable.
npm -v gives env: node: No such file or directory

brew link node y brew postinstall node dar el mismo error

brew doctor me da otro montón de advertencias:

Warning: Unbrewed header files were found in /usr/local/include.
If you didn't put them there on purpose they could cause problems when
building Homebrew formulae, and may need to be deleted.

Warning: You have unlinked kegs in your Cellar
Leaving kegs unlinked can lead to build-trouble and cause brews that depend on
those kegs to fail to run properly once built. Run `brew link` on these:
node

Warning: Broken symlinks were found. Remove them with `brew prune`:

brew prune da error: Permission denied @ unlink_internal - /usr/local/lib/node_modules/npm/node_modules/.bin/JSONStream

jotyhista
fuente
Tienes que volver a instalar la cerveza! prueba / usr / bin / ruby ​​-e "$ (curl -fsSL) raw.githubusercontent.com/Homebrew/install/master/install ) "
Rizwan atta
o intente actualizar brew
Rizwan atta
@Rizwanatta Intenté desinstalar / reinstalar Homebrew pero eso no solucionó el problema
jotyhista